B2B-2 Referral Group

Date: January 6, 2022

Time: 8:30 AM – 9:30 AM CST

Website: Dubuque Area Chamber B2B

Event Description:

Does your organization depend on word of mouth marketing?  Are you looking for more effective ways to get the word out about the services your organization provides?  

Look no further!  The Chamber’s B2B Referral Group is your answer to all these questions.

Each Thursday, from 8:30 am – 9:30 am in the Chamber Boardroom, area Chamber members from different business categories meet to share referrals that are useful for the participants of the group.
